Sales Tax Bar Associate Urges Finance Minister to Extend Tax Audit Report Filing Due Date for AY 2025-26

The Sales Bar Association, an association of Tax Professionals in India, has submitted a formal request to the Hon’ble Union Minister of Finance, Smt Nirmala Sitharaman, regarding the extension of the due date for filing the Tax Audit Reports for the Assessment Year 2025-26.

The Bar submitted that it has nearly 2000 members, including Advocates, Chartered Accountants (CAs) and Tax Practitioners. Their members were appointed to key positions like judges in the Delhi High Court and some as members of the Income Tax Appellate Tribunal (ITAT) and Goods and Services Tax Appellate Tribunal (GSTAT).

The Bar has requested to extend the due date of filing tax audit reports for Assessment Year 2025-26 under the Income Tax Act, 1961, until November 15, 2025, giving enough time between the ITR filing and the TAR filing to ensure timely compliance. The Bar has also requested to avoid releasing the notification at the last minute. It requested the notification to be released in advance so that the taxpayers do not panic or face any other difficulties.

This extension is much needed, as it will not only improve the accuracy and quality of reporting but also deepen the relationship of mutual trust between the tax authority and the stakeholders.
